What they do

A Kitchen Staff assists with food preparation as directed by cooks, food supervisors or chefs. Cleans kitchen work areas and dishes. Prepares ingredients for dishes to be cooked, prepares beverages, and stocks salad bars or buffet tables.

$35,397 / year median in New Jersey

+4% projected growth

Job Description

The Taco Bell Team Member is the first and last face that customers see when they walk through the door and only because of YOU that our customers keeping returning to fulfill their cravings. You bring the great Taco Bell tastes to life by building delicious menu items according to standard. You enjoy people and providing friendly, accurate service to customers as well as your teammates and managers. " You are applying for work with a franchisee of Taco Bell, not Taco Bell Corp. or any of its affiliates. If hired, the franchisee will be your only employer. Franchisees are independent business owners who set their own wage and benefit programs that can vary among franchisees."
Responsibilities:
Greeting guests with a smile Accrurately preparing food and beverage orders Being friendly and helpful to customers and co-workers Maintaining a clean work environment Answering questions about menu items and promotions Working well with teammates and accepting coaching from management team
Requirements:
Min age of 17 years old Possess all documents and permits required by state & federal law Results oriented and customer focused Having a clean and tidy appearance and work habits Being able to work in a fast paced environment Company Introduction We believe everyone deserves to Live Más
